Hey All, ust want to say, the Cayuga Bird Club sponsored bird walks at Sapsucker Woods are on track to resume this weekend. Temperatures Saturday morning will be cold ,but I think will moderate quickly and Sunday AM looks almost balmy,in the 20's. Both Saturday and Sunday walks start at 9 AM and last about 1 1/2 hours. Meet at the portico to the Visitors' Center. Binoculars are available. These walks are targeted to beginners but suitable for all levels. Aren't you just dying to get out?
